The European Heritage of Chemin de Fer

Chemin de Fer represents one of the oldest and most interactive styles of baccarat, widely celebrated in traditional European gaming rooms. Unlike standard casino setups where the house handles all banking duties, participants take turns acting as the banker themselves. This format introduces a crucial element of active decision-making, as the banker can choose whether to draw a third card based on the opponent's strategy.

The social dynamic at a Chemin de Fer table creates a highly engaging atmosphere that appeals to seasoned players. Because the role of the banker rotates around the table, the tactical responsibility continuously shifts among the participants. The Swift Efficiency of Mini Baccarat

Mini Baccarat scales down the grandeur of the traditional game into a faster, more accessible format suitable for all bankrolls. It is typically played on smaller tables resembling standard blackjack layouts, which effectively removes the formal atmosphere often found in high-limit areas. The dealer manages every phase of the game, ensuring rapid rounds that maximize the action within brief sessions.

This variation maintains the exact same mathematical edge and fundamental rules as the classic version while drastically increasing the pace of play. Newcomers frequently use this format as a practical training ground to master their betting patterns before transitioning to complex setups. The Grand Structure of Baccarat Banque

Baccarat Banque stands out as another classic variation that shares similarities with Chemin de Fer but features a fixed banking position. In this format, the bank is generally retained by the player who is willing to wager the highest financial stake. This structure creates an intense, adversarial environment where the table collectively competes against a single dominant entity.

The shoe is divided into separate hands, allowing the banker to simultaneously play against two distinct sides of the table. This complex arrangement demands a deep understanding of standard probabilities and card distribution patterns.
